Call or ask a Library staff member at any of our … WebNov 16, 2024 · Reading aloud is one of the most important things parents and teachers can do with children. Reading aloud builds many important foundational skills, introduces vocabulary, provides a model of fluent, expressive reading, and helps children recognize what reading for pleasure is all about. Use animal voices, incorporate actions, engage the senses, point out... Web• Reading aloud gives children background knowl-edge, which helps them make sense of what they see, hear, and read. The more adults read aloud to children, the larger their vocabularies will grow and the more they will know about the world and their place in it. • Reading aloud lets parents and teachers be role models for reading.
